How to clean wool?
Wool primary processing: 1 wool selection -2 wool opening -3 wool washing -4 drying-(carbonization and impurity removal) -4 wool blending -5 wool oil -6 combing -7 needle thinning -8 combing -9 water washing-10 international sliver making and combing. Before spinning and combing wool, the washed loose wool should be processed into combed tops, which is called top manufacturing project. In the production process of combed wool spinning, wool will become very clean, so as to prepare for the next step (1). Wool to be cut from sheep is called raw wool. Because the raw wool is mixed with various physiological impurities and dirt in the living environment, it can not be directly put into wool spinning production. Therefore, a series of chemical and mechanical methods must be adopted to remove impurities to meet the requirements of wool spinning production. This series of treatments are all wool. Preliminary processing, the processed wool fiber is called wool washing. The production process of raw wool preparation is: wool selection-opening-washing-drying. For raw materials with more impurities, carbonation is allowed to remove plant impurities 1, and wool selection lt; /span>。 2. Most of the sorted wool is lumpy, and the fibers are tightly wound, which is not conducive to wool washing and impurity removal. Therefore, before wool washing, it is necessary to open and remove impurities from the raw wool with a opener to improve the efficiency and quality of wool washing. 3. The purpose of wool washing is to wash off lanolin, sheep sweat, sand and dirt on wool fibers, and the key is to wash off lanolin. The method adopted is to add washing liquid containing detergent, and the detergent penetrates into the gap of the dirt layer of wool grease, reducing the binding force between the dirt layer and wool fibers, so that the dirt layer is separated from the wool surface and transferred to the washing liquid. At the same time, the lanolin emulsified by glass suspends the dirt and impurities in the washing solution and will not return to the wool fiber, thus achieving the purpose of washing all the way. Commonly used detergents are mainly soap-based and synthetic detergents. In the washing tank, it is necessary to use mechanical action to push, squeeze and wash wool to improve its decontamination efficiency. 4. Wool washing after drying and washing generally contains about 40% moisture, and it must be dried before storage or transportation. Drying is carried out on a dryer that can generate circulating air with a certain flow rate and temperature, so that the moisture on the surface of wool can be evaporated and the purpose of rapid drying can be achieved. At present, all factories use washing and drying machines to finish opening, washing and drying, and get washed wool. 5. Some plant impurities in carbonized raw wool, such as grass thorns and leaves, are closely intertwined with wool and are not completely removed during opening and washing. In order to ensure the processing quality of the next process, a weeding process should be added, that is, impurities should be completely removed by mechanical or chemical methods. Mechanical weeding is to loosen wool and separate impurities through mechanical carding. Its disadvantage is that weeding can not stabilize the bottom and damage the fiber length greatly, so it has been rarely used. The method of weeding by chemical action is called carbonization. The principle of this method is that, in view of the acid resistance of wool and plant impurities, the grass-containing wool is treated with sulfuric acid solution, then dried and baked, so that the grass-containing impurities become fragile carbon, thus separating it from wool and achieving the purpose of impurity removal.
